Key Ingredients to Elevate Your Casino Menu
To craft an enticing casino menu that stands out, you’ll need key Mexican ingredients that can shine in a variety of dishes. Here are some foundational items to consider:
- Dried Chilies: Essential for creating salsas and sauces, dried chiles like ancho and guajillo provide depth and complexity.
- Corn Tortillas: Fresh, handmade tortillas can serve as the base for tacos or as a side for many dishes, offering authenticity.
- Beans: Black beans and pinto beans are staples that provide a nutritious base—perfect for dips or as a side dish.
- Fresh Herbs: Ingredients like cilantro and oregano enhance flavors and aromas in all your meals.
- Cheeses: Varieties like queso fresco and cotija add creaminess and sharpness to your offerings.
